Ceisteanna—Questions. Oral Answers. - County Sligo Water Supply.

27.

asked the Minister for Local Government when a water supply will be provided for the people of Calry, County Sligo, as lack of water is causing severe hardship to those people; from what source the supply will be taken; and if there are plans to provide a supply to the whole parish.

I am not in a position to say when a new water supply scheme will be provided for Calry. I understand that the consulting engineer's preliminary report for a scheme for Calry-Kiltycahill areas based on the existing spring source for the present Calry supply and on another spring source at Keelogyboy is at present being examined by the council's technical staff.
